Delphi Control Arm P/N:TC1483

Delphi

$76.53

SKU:
BBMXTC1483
UPC:
689604252710
MPN:
TC1483
Condition:
New
Position:
FRONT LEFT LOWER FORWARD
Adding to cart… The item has been added